Abstract

The study was conducted during the season 2020-2021 in the Ramadi city western Iraq. In order to know the effect of Brassinolide on the growth characteristics and yield of three varieties of wheat (Abu-Ghreib, IPA-99 and Bhooth 10). A Randomized Complete Block Design (RCBD) arranged according to split-plots used with three replicates and 36 experimental units, four concentrations of Brassinolide (0, 2, 4, 6 mg L−1) were used in Main-plots (B0, B1, B2, B3) respectively, which was sprayed when flowering started. While three varieties of wheat (Abu-Ghreib, IPA-99 and Bhooth-10) were used in sub-plots (V1, V2, V3) respectively. The Concentration B3, variety V3, and the overlap B2×V3 gave the highest rates of grain yield, as it reached (9.95, 9.96 and 12.97 t.ha−1) respectively. As for the weight of 1000 grain no significant differences were shown among the concentrations of Brassinolide, while the variety V3 was significantly superior (35.23 g), there were no significant differences between the two study factors. Superiority of concentration B3, the variety V2 and the overlap B3×V2 by giving the highest mean for the trait of the number of grains per spike (56.70, 50.68 and 65.33 grain.spike−1) respectively. Superiority the concentration B3 and variety V3 by giving the highest mean the number of spikes per square meter (707.56 and 703.45 spike.m2) respectively, no significant differences appeared between the two factors of the study.
